Police investigating false threat to Sangamon Valley Schools | Local News

News RoomBy News RoomAugust 7, 2026Updated:August 8, 20263 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est WhatsApp Telegram Email LinkedIn Tumblr

The Sangamon Valley School District in Illiopolis, Illinois, recently experienced a frightening ordeal when local authorities were alerted to a potential security threat on campus. This past Friday, the Sangamon County Sheriff’s Department received a phone call alleging that there was a dangerous situation unfolding within a bathroom at the district’s Illiopolis facility, which serves as the home for both the middle school and the intermediate school. For any community, a report of this nature—especially in an era where school safety is a constant, heavy concern—creates an immediate sense of alarm that reverberates through parents, faculty, and local families.

Upon receiving the notification from the sheriff’s department, the school district acted with swift urgency to ensure that no one was in harm’s way. Fortunately, the administration confirmed that no students were present on the campus at the time the call was placed, which provided a small, much-needed measure of relief in an otherwise volatile situation. Despite the absence of students, the school staff and district leadership did not hesitate to activate their established safety protocols, prioritizing caution and preparedness above all else to secure the grounds.

As the situation unfolded, law enforcement officers descended upon the school campus to conduct a thorough and meticulous search of the premises. The sight of squad cars and the presence of deputies inside a school building is always a jarring image for a small town, serving as a stark reminder of the fragile nature of school security. During their sweep of the facility, the deputies left no corner unchecked, ensuring that every hallway, classroom, and restroom was examined to rule out the possibility of any hidden danger or suspicious items that might threaten the safety of the student body.

After a rigorous inspection of the buildings, the sheriff’s department reached a clear conclusion: the entire incident was nothing more than a malicious prank. While the discovery that there was no real threat brought an end to the immediate crisis, it did little to diminish the frustration and seriousness of the event. False reports of this nature—often referred to as “swatting” in similar contexts—are never viewed as harmless jokes by law enforcement or school administrators. Instead, they are recognized as dangerous disruptions that waste valuable public resources and inflict unnecessary psychological distress on an entire community.

Currently, the Sangamon County Sheriff’s Department remains actively engaged in an investigation to identify the individual or individuals responsible for making the false report. Tracking down the source of such a call is a priority, as accountability is essential to deter future incidents and to send a message that the security of our schools is not a subject for games. The district has been transparent in its communication, sending letters to families and staff to ensure that everyone is informed of both the nature of the threat and the fact that the campus was eventually declared safe.

In the aftermath of this incident, the focus for the Illiopolis community will likely shift toward healing and reinforcement of their security measures. While this particular event ended without physical harm, the emotional toll of such a scare serves as a poignant reminder of the vigilance required by modern school districts. As the investigation into the origin of the prank call continues, the community remains united in its commitment to providing a safe, secure environment for its children, ensuring that the peace of mind of students and parents remains the top priority moving forward.
